Before you worry about claims, focus on safety and medical care. Then, while the crash is still fresh, take these steps:

  1. Document the scene while it’s still accurate

    • Photos of the intersection/roadway, lane position, signals/signage, and any hazards
    • Vehicle position relative to where you were riding
    • Your bicycle condition and any visible damage
  2. Get medical evaluation and keep records organized

    • Don’t delay care because symptoms feel “minor” at first
    • Save discharge paperwork, test results, treatment plans, and follow-ups
  3. Write down a timeline you can trust

    • What you remember about traffic conditions, timing, and the sequence of events
    • Names and contact info for witnesses (even if you think the police report covers it)
  4. Be careful with insurance statements

    • Insurers may ask for details before your medical picture is stable
    • A rushed statement can be used to challenge causation or fault

While every incident is unique, certain scenarios are more common in coastal and commuter-heavy areas like Half Moon Bay:

  • Right-turn and left-turn collisions at intersections where turning vehicles may not fully account for bicyclists’ lane position
  • Door-zone incidents when cyclists pass parked vehicles and drivers open doors without ensuring the lane is clear
  • Merging and lane-change crashes where a vehicle shifts into the cyclist’s path
  • Hazard-related falls involving debris, uneven pavement, construction changes, or poor roadway visibility
  • Tourist and visitor traffic conflicts, especially during peak seasons when unfamiliar drivers and busier roads increase unpredictability

Even if you believe you “did everything right,” liability disputes often hinge on specific details—timing, sight lines, and what the other driver should have done.


In California, bicycle injury claims frequently involve disagreements over:

  • Whether the driver failed to yield or maintain a proper lookout
  • Whether lane positioning and speed were reasonable under the circumstances
  • Whether the cyclist’s actions contributed to the crash

That’s why your evidence matters. A strong case typically ties together:

  • Crash documentation (photos, reports, witness statements)
  • Medical findings (diagnoses, imaging, treatment progression)
  • A clear explanation of how the injury matches the crash mechanism
